2nd Transnational Meeting of the Erasmus+ project “DIGITAL TEACHERS – Classrooms Without Borders Created with Digital Technologies in Estonia

The second Transnational Meeting of the Erasmus+ project “DIGITAL TEACHERS – Classrooms Without Borders Created with Digital Technologies (2022-2-EE01-KA220-SCH-000094917) took place from 27 to 28 October, in Tartu, Estonia, and was held with great success at Luunja Keskkool , which is the coordinating school. The participants who represented the Agrupamento de Escolas Terras do Ave at this event were teachers Alexandre Sousa, coordinator of this project at the group, and Clara Verónico, both members of the Erasmus+ team. The agenda included topics such as the dissemination of activities, the presentation of the program for the next LTTA3 that will take place in Rafina, Greece, reflections and an update on the work developed and to be developed.
